Dedicated and Flexible Carers

Our care manager (whose background is in nursing) will visit you to conduct an initial assessment. This is a friendly information sharing visit which will ascertain exactly what level of care is right for you. 

This information will then form the care plan. Your needs may change through time and therefore, your care plan will reflect this. Each month your appointed Team Leader will visit to see if you are happy with the level of care you are receiving and also if you have any concerns.
All our carers go through an interview process, supply 2 references and are DBS checked. They complete induction training which includes moving and handling, medication and infection control prior to carrying out shadow shifts to ensure they deliver competent and safe care. 
New carers work alongside senior staff who mentor them to a stage where they are competent and they feel confident. Ongoing training is sourced in-house and provided throughout the year covering subjects in order that the carers provide excellent practice and meet all your needs. Specialist training, such as insulin administration, PEG feeding, is sourced externally
